Bạn cần đăng nhập để đánh giá tài liệu

Giải Tin học 10 trang 143 Kết nối tri thức

870

Với giải SGK Tin học 10 Kết nối tri thức trang 143 chi tiết trong Bài 29: Nhận biết lỗi chương trình giúp học sinh dễ dàng xem và so sánh lời giải từ đó biết cách làm bài tập Tin học 10. Mời các bạn đón xem:

Giải Tin học 10 trang 143 Kết nối tri thức

2. Một số lỗi ngoại lệ thường gặp

Hoạt động 2 trang 143 SGK Tin học 10: Đọc, thảo luận để nhận biết một số lỗi ngoại lệ thường gặp trong chương trình Python.

Phương pháp giải:

Dựa vào lý thuyết trong phần 2. Một số lỗi ngoại lệ thường gặp

Lời giải:

 (ảnh 1)

Mục 2 trang 143 SGK Tin học 10: Hãy nêu mã ngoại lệ của mỗi lệnh sau nếu xảy ra lỗi.

 (ảnh 1)

Phương pháp giải:

Một số mã lỗi ngoại lệ:ZeroDivisionError, IndexError, NameError, TypeError, ValueError, IndentationError, SyntaxError.

Lời giải:

a) Lỗi kiểu dữ liệu: TypeError         

b) Lỗi giá trị dữ liệu: ValueError

c) Lỗi kiểu dữ liệu: TypeError           

d) Nếu có lỗi xảy ra thì có thể là các loại lỗi sau đây: TypeError nếu dữ liệu (số 10) truyền vào đối số của hàm x() bị sai kiểu, hoặc NameError nếu hàm x() chưa được định nghĩa trước đó, hoặc TypeError nếu giá trị trả lại của hàm x(10) không cùng kiểu để có thể thực hiện phép toán 12 + x(10).

Xem thêm các bài giải Tin học 10 Kết nối tri thức hay, chi tiết khác:

Giải Tin học 10 trang 141 Kết nối tri thức

Giải Tin học 10 trang 142 Kết nối tri thức

Giải Tin học 10 trang 144 Kết nối tri thức

Đánh giá

0

0 đánh giá